Amazon Health Service’s (“AHS”) Compliance team is seeking a Government Programs Compliance Manager responsible for executing on the day-to-day operations of Amazon Health’s Government Programs Compliance pillar, supporting Amazon Pharmacy (“AP”). The candidate will be responsible for ensuring pharmacy revenue integrity and assessing any potential overpayment matters by working cross-functionally with stakeholder teams (e.g. Data Analytics, Finance, Legal, Operations, etc) and collaborating on corrective and preventive action plans. This role will be innovative and maintain a high bar of compliance and operational excellence as we rapidly grow, scale, and innovate and ultimately make AP the most customer-centric pharmacy on Earth. Key job responsibilities
- Maintain and deliver an effective potential overpayments process to ensure pharmacy revenue integrity
- Review and report the status of potential overpayment matters to the Sr Mgr. Government Programs Compliance, AP Compliance Officer, and AHS Chief Compliance Officer
- Ensure adherence to timelines are met, escalating when appropriate
- Develop and maintain effective business relationships by attending business meetings, job shadowing to learn more about the people, systems and processes of each area, and establish a regular frequency of meeting to discuss potential overpayment matters
- Serve as a resource and compliance subject matter expert related to submitting claims to government healthcare programs
A day in the life
- Work with cross functional stakeholders to drive end-to-end completion of compliance initiatives and goals
- Influence without authority to ensure potential overpayment matters are prioritized
- Collaborate on developing corrective and preventive action plans
- Educate stakeholder teams on processes for potential overpayment escalations
